Base type and lamp specifications
The main question that car owners have is: what base used in headlight? For low beam Nissan Almera Classic (body B10) standard type provided H7. This is the most common type of automotive lamps, which is characterized by high reliability and a wide range of available analogues on the market.
It is important to understand that a single headlight often uses two different types of bulbs: one for low beam and one for high beam. In this model, high beam is usually implemented through a lamp with a socket H4 (double-strand) or a separate block, but for the neighbor you are always looking for exactly H7. Do not confuse these types as their designs and mounting locations are different and attempting to insert an H4 into an H7 socket will cause the headlight bulbs to break.
The power of the standard lamp is 55 Watt. This is a standard setting for most passenger cars, providing the necessary light flow without overheating the reflector. However, modern technology allows the use of lamps with slightly higher wattage or improved color temperature, but this must be done with caution.
The color temperature of standard halogen lamps is usually in the range 3000–3200 Kelvin, which gives a yellowish, warm light. This spectrum copes best with fog and rain, penetrating through droplets of moisture. If you decide to replace them with xenon or high-power LED lamps with a temperature of 6000 K or higher, the light will become cool white, but the lighting efficiency may be reduced in bad weather.

Features of installing LED and xenon lamps
Many car owners ask: Is it possible to install LED instead of halogen? This is technically possible, since the H7 base is compatible with modern LED modules. However, standard optics Nissan Almera Classic designed specifically for halogen lamps with a certain glow point of the filament.
Installing high-power LEDs without a lens often results in the light being dispersed incorrectly. You may be blinded by oncoming drivers even if you can see the road clearly. In addition, LED lamps have an ignition unit, which can cause errors on the dashboard or incorrect operation of the lighting system.
If you decide to upgrade, look for LED lamps with a built-in fan and the correct crystal geometry, simulating a filament. This will help keep the light focused. But remember that xenon installation into a reflector headlight without a lens is a traffic violation and is punishable by a fine and confiscation of the equipment.
⚠️ Attention! The installation of xenon lamps in standard halogen headlights without lenses is strictly prohibited by Russian legislation. This creates dangerous light for oncoming traffic and can cause an accident.
In addition, LED lamps emit heat not towards the reflector, but towards the base. If the lamp does not have high-quality cooling, the radiator can melt the plastic housing of the headlight or the connection block. Be sure to check the radiator dimensions before purchasing.

Step-by-step instructions for replacing the lamp
Replacing the low beam lamp with Nissan Almera Classic - The procedure is simple, but requires accuracy. You don't need to remove the entire headlight, just access the rear headlight cover from the engine compartment. The process will take you no more than 15 minutes.
You will need new bulbs and possibly gloves to avoid touching the bulb glass with your bare hands. Oil from fingers on a halogen lamp leads to local overheating and rapid burnout. If you do touch it, wipe the flask with alcohol before installing.
For convenience, prepare the following set of tools and actions:
☑️ Preparing to replace the lamp
- Open the hood of the car and locate the rear of the headlight on the desired side.
- Locate the rubber or plastic protective cap that covers the lamp socket.
- Remove the cover by turning it counterclockwise or simply pulling it (depending on the version).
- Disconnect the power connector by pressing the latch and carefully remove the lamp.
It is important not to use too much force, as the plastic on older cars becomes brittle. If the latch does not budge, try rocking it slightly, but do not jerk it sharply.
Insert the new lamp into the socket, making sure that it is seated all the way and that the contact pins align with the slots. Secure the lamp with a spring clamp, if provided by the design.
Connect the power connector and return the protective cover to its place, pressing it firmly. Check the operation of the lamps by turning on the lights before closing the hood.
Before installing a new lamp, be sure to turn on the side lights and check that the reflector inside the headlight is not damaged. A dirty or darkened reflector will reduce the efficiency of even a new lamp by 50%.
Frequent problems and causes of rapid burnout
If the bulbs burn out too often, it may indicate hidden problems in the vehicle's electrical system. One of the main reasons is voltage drops in the on-board network. Generator Nissan Almera Classic can produce surges exceeding the norm of 14.5 Volts, which kills the filament.
Another common problem is poor contact in the chuck. Oxidation of contacts leads to heating and burning of the plastic. Inspect the connection block: if the metal is darkened or melted, you need to replace the connector or clean the contacts with sandpaper.
It is also worth checking the tightness of the headlight. Moisture getting inside leads to the formation of condensation, which causes a short circuit and a sharp jump in current when turned on. If you see water droplets inside the glass, check the rubber seal and vents.
The main reasons for frequent breakdowns:
- ⚡ Unstable voltage of the generator or relay regulator
- 💧 Moisture getting inside the headlight due to a leaky seal
- 🔥 Overheating of the lamp due to touching with hands or poor ventilation
- 🔌 Oxidation of contacts in the power supply
⚠️ Attention! If the lamp burns out within a few days after replacement, do not immediately buy a new one. Most likely, the problem is not in the lamp itself, but in the car's electrics. Diagnostics of the generator and wiring is necessary.
Regularly checking the contacts and cleaning the reflector can double the life of the lamps, even when using budget models.
The influence of headlight glass quality on luminous flux
Even the most expensive lamp will not be able to provide adequate illumination if the headlight glass is cloudy. Over time, the plastic turns yellow and becomes covered with micro-scratches from sand and washing. This reduces transparency and diffuses the light, making it less bright and directional.
For Nissan Almera Classic characterized by rapid clouding of headlights, since plastic loses its properties over time under the influence of ultraviolet radiation. If you've replaced your bulbs and still don't get enough light, try polishing your headlights or replacing them with new ones.
Polishing allows you to restore transparency, but it removes the protective layer, so after the procedure it is necessary to cover the headlight with varnish or a special protective film. Otherwise, in a month they will become cloudy again.

FAQ: Frequently asked questions
Can H7 lamps be used with higher voltage?
No, you cannot use 12 Volt lamps with increased voltage in a 12 V network. This will lead to instant burnout. If you want more light, choose models labeled "Extra Light" or "Racing", but keep the standard 12V voltage.
How often do you need to change low beam bulbs on an Almera Classic?
The average service life of halogen lamps is from 300 to 500 hours of operation. In real conditions, this is usually 1–2 years. It is recommended to change lamps in pairs to avoid differences in brightness and color temperature.
What to do if the new lamp does not light up?
Check that the connector is securely connected. If the contact is good, check the fuse. B Nissan Almera Classic A separate fuse in the mounting block is responsible for the low beam. If the fuse is intact, there may be a problem with the relay or wiring.
